What is Cosplay?
Cosplay (a.k.a. "Costume Play") refers to the activity of dressing up in costume.  The term cosplay, or “ko-su-pu-re,” originates from Japan, where cosplay is a popular form of entertainment among children and young adults.  Japanese cosplayers frequently attend costume role playing parties and the ComicMarket to celebrate and be seen.  Cosplay costumes are not limited to a particular theme.  Cosplayers enjoy dressing up and performing as their favorite fantasy, Sci-fi, anime, manga and game characters.  Cosplay is the Japanese version of western “Fan Masquerade" and “Hall Costuming” combined.
